Transaction 67a93de31ac65699d5856acc236c250ccb7b2e8f03824923e661902c955da628
1 Input
1 Output
-
67a93de31ac65699d5856acc236c250ccb7b2e8f03824923e661902c955da628:0
- value
- 124130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be831acb523930026797172869b9947169f1579e OP_EQUAL
- address
- 3K4MNJYivLYC1Ww4GB8R8D15pvMR551NXd